I had the same problem with my bike when purchased new last year. I was told that it would improve with time and it has. Although still not perfect, it seems to be getting better and better with increased miles. Try letting out the clutch slowly and pressing down on the shift lever at the same time. Whenever mine still acts up, this seems to produce the normal click into gear that is missing. It should go into gear at the beginning of the clutch engagement point. After it does, just pull the lever back again and you are ready to take-off normally. When I took my bike in for the 500 mile service, the Service Manager showed me this trick, and it works everytime.
